Les "scènes" de Home Assistant: ce qu'ils sont et comment ils fonctionnent

1 minutes de lecture

Les scènes sont un outil très pratique pour définir les conditions arbitraires d’un ou de plusieurs entité présent dans le propremière domotique personnelle basée sur Home Assistant.Home Assistant Logo officiel

Les scènes sont définies par la configuration duHUB et déterminer la création d'entités appelées "scene.nome_della_scena« ; ces entités, associées au service "scene.turn_on“, Cela signifie que les entités incluses dans elles assument le statut indiqué.

Si, par exemple, nous voulions définir une scène de "bonne nuit" dans laquelle toutes les lumières étaient éteintes, il serait possible de le faire via une scène dans laquelle nous indiquerions toutes les entités impliquées associées à l'État "offre». Performer "scene.turn_on"Associé à l'entité" scènes. Bonne nuit ", toutes les lumières (indiquées) s'éteignent à l'unisson.

La chose intéressante est que les entités de type de scène peuvent être facilement exposées aux haut-parleurs intelligents, nous permettant ainsi de les exécuter via des commandes vocales.

Nb À partir de la version 0.102.x de Home Assistant un éditeur visuel pratique pour définir les scènes a été ajouté.

Exemple

Prenons un exemple de scène:

scene:
  - name: TV
    entities:
      light.artemide: off
      light.angolo: off
      light.led_tv:
        state: true
        xy_color: [0.33, 0.66]
        brightness: 200

Cette scène, appelée "scene.tv", Provoque les lumières dans la chambre ("light.artemide"Et"light.angolo") Eteignez et la lumière" light.led_tv "s'allume: c'est une lumière RVB (comme les contrôleurs Maison magique, ou le Philips HUE, par exemple), la couleur et le niveau par défaut sont également définis lumide brillance.

Aussi facile à imaginer, il est possible de définir combien de scènes tu veux.

Nb Pour une limitation proil n'est pas possible de définir - dans la même scène - plusieurs états pour la même entité. Si cela est nécessaire, il est préférable d’utiliser une séquence à travers scénario.

Comment évoquer des scènes

Comme prévu, un excellent domaine de appLes enceintes de la scène sont les enceintes intelligentes, mais pas seulement.

aussi automations di Home Assistant sont une portée de applished ici très typique: effectuer automatiquement une scène face à une condition spécifique (trivialement, rentrer à la maison) est particulièrement pratique.

Pour évoquer une scène, la syntaxe en automatisation est très simple:

automation:
  alias: "Automazione scena"
  trigger: []
  condition: []
  action:
    service: scene.turn_on
    entity_id: scene.nomescena

Selon trigger choisi, automatisation "automation.automazione_scena" provvede effectuer la scène indiquée (dans l'exemple, "scene.nomescena».


télégramme

Restez à jour par le nôtre Chaîne de télégramme!